One thing with the Xeno, if you look at the instructions for testing it it tells you that the LED on the chip will flash different colors depending on if it's working or not. On the current chips this is a lie, the LED doesn't change colors. I reinstalled my chip like 5 times before I finally just threw a burned copy of F-Zero GX and found that it worked fine.
